Mac & anaconda使用 初步,不定期添加

本文介绍如何使用Anaconda创建新环境及快速下载所需库的方法。包括使用命令行创建环境、激活和切换环境,以及通过添加国内镜像源加速下载,或离线安装库。
部署运行你感兴趣的模型镜像

# NOTE&PS:我的电脑控制台的开始是这样的(base) apple@XXXX~ %  XXXX是我在图片里涂掉的部分,呔--

 

1.创建新环境

anaconda的图形界面挺好的,但是有一点:如果你是用的清华镜像下载的anaconda(其他下载源没试过不知道是不是也是这样),可能在新建环境上只能选一个Python环境去新建,然后我们就打开终端用命令行去新建环境就可以了,语句如下:

conda create -n 你的环境名字 python=3.6  #你想指定环境是啥就是啥吧

然后成功的话就可以在anaconda中可看到你创建的新环境

2.激活、切换已有的各个环境

Windows的命令行是:activate 你的环境名字

OS是 source activate 你的环境名字

(如果不切换是base)

 

参考链接:https://blog.youkuaiyun.com/qq_38742161/article/details/109291008?utm_medium=distribute.pc_relevant.none-task-blog-title-2&spm=1001.2101.3001.4242

 

3.快速下载需要的库(添加镜像&离线下载)

       接着我们就开始下库,可用多种方法下载:在anaconda中利用图形界面直接下载;进入控制台利用命令行下载等

       然后我们就会发现下载的特别慢,还特别容易出现HTTP0000错误,或者提示:HTTP errors are often intermittent, and a simple retry will get you on your way.

       这时候可以继续头铁下载,也可以有一些改进措施:       (以下措施不冲突,一个不行可以换下一个)


方法1:

原因:由于这些库的“官方版”在国外,就很慢,用VPN也不行,还是慢。所以可以考虑利用国内镜像来下载这些库,原来下载的时候位置可能是这样的anaconda/cloud/conda-forge/osx-64::chardet-4.0.0-py36h79c6626_0,但是我们通过向conda中添加下载源:即把国内的下载镜像网址加入到conda中,就可以加速下载,此时的下载源(可能,因为不一定就只是调用清华的镜像)就是这样的了https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ud/conda-forge

具体步骤是:

(1)首先肯定要激活要下库的环境,source activate 对应环境的名字

(2)输入以下命令即就可以添加这些镜像作为下载源了

conda config --add channels https://mirrors.ustc.edu.cn/anaconda/pkgs/main/
conda config --add channels https://mirrors.ustc.edu.cn/anaconda/pkgs/free/
conda config --add channels https://mirrors.ustc.edu.cn/anaconda/cloud/conda-forge/
conda config --add channels https://mirrors.ustc.edu.cn/anaconda/cloud/msys2/
conda config --add channels https://mirrors.ustc.edu.cn/anaconda/cloud/bioconda/
conda config --add channels https://mirrors.ustc.edu.cn/anaconda/cloud/menpo/

(3)然后还是该怎么下怎么下。Eg. conda install 要下载的库名字

注意:第二步骤只需要一遍就够了,下一次在下点什么其他的库就不需要再次添加镜像了


方法2:

(1)首先肯定要激活要下库的环境,source activate 对应环境的名字

(2)去对应的镜像上找到要下的库,将他下载下来。

          如果不知道下载什么环境的,可以先emmmmm,自己看看自己的cuda和Python环境决定(少方法待补充)

(3)选好要下载的库(.bz2后缀的)并下载,然后到控制台输入如下语句:

conda install 该库下载的位置/库的名字

  如下图示,(PS,我把库放在桌面上了,所以路径是/Users/apple/Desktop ,然后再加上 下载下来的 库的 名字就可以啦

  

 

(友情提示,可以在控制台输入 conda install 后把下载下来的库文件拖到控制台中,对应路径和文件名就都补全了)

参考链接:     感谢大佬们!

在离线环境下怎么通过Anaconda安装XXX https://www.zhihu.com/question/45987778

Anaconda升级与Spyder升级与报错处理(镜像源更新设置) https://blog.youkuaiyun.com/ZYC88888/article/details/103761827

python 常用的几个镜像仓库:https://blog.youkuaiyun.com/yamadeee/article/details/80178996

 

 

 

您可能感兴趣的与本文相关的镜像

Python3.8

Python3.8

Conda
Python

Python 是一种高级、解释型、通用的编程语言,以其简洁易读的语法而闻名,适用于广泛的应用,包括Web开发、数据分析、人工智能和自动化脚本

评论
成就一亿技术人!
拼手气红包6.0元
还能输入1000个字符
 
红包 添加红包
表情包 插入表情
 条评论被折叠 查看
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值